        Remarks & Notes 
        Correctly stepping off trailing foot first -- opposite the direction of travel -- the brakeman of Rock Island 82 steps down to throw the switch at Sandown Junction east of Denver, February 14, 1967. In a few moments U25B 224 will enter Union Pacific’s Kansas City line for the journey east to Limon, where it will regain its own rails east to Chicago.
